# §13220. Biodiesel fuel use credits

- (a) **Allocation of credits—**
  - (1) **In general—** The [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) shall allocate one credit under this section to a [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) for each qualifying volume of the biodiesel component of fuel containing at least 20 percent biodiesel by volume purchased after the date of the enactment of this section, for use by the [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) in vehicles owned or operated by the [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) that weigh more than 8,500 pounds gross vehicle weight rating.
  - (2) **Exceptions—** No credits shall be allocated under [paragraph (1)](#a-1) for a purchase of biodiesel—
    - (A) for use in [alternative fueled vehicles](/usc/42/13211.md?p=3-A); or
    - (B) that is required by Federal or [State](/usc/42/2021b.md?p=14) law.
  - (3) **Authority to modify percentage—** The [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) may, by rule, lower the 20 percent biodiesel volume requirement in [paragraph (1)](#a-1) for reasons related to cold start, safety, or vehicle function considerations.
  - (4) **Documentation—** A [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) seeking a credit under this section shall provide written documentation to the [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) supporting the [allocation](/usc/42/2021b.md?p=2) of a credit to such [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) under [paragraph (1)](#a-1).
- (b) **Use of credits—**
  - (1) **In general—** At the request of a [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) allocated a credit under [subsection (a)](#a), the [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) shall, for the year in which the purchase of a qualifying volume is made, treat that purchase as the acquisition of one [alternative fueled vehicle](/usc/42/13211.md?p=3-A) the [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) is required to acquire under this subchapter, subchapter II, or subchapter III.
  - (2) **Limitation—** Credits allocated under [subsection (a)](#a) may not be used to satisfy more than 50 percent of the [alternative fueled vehicle](/usc/42/13211.md?p=3-A) requirements of a [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) under this subchapter, subchapter II, and subchapter III. This paragraph shall not apply to a [fleet](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) or [covered person](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) that is a biodiesel [alternative fuel](/usc/42/13211.md?p=2) provider described in [section 13251(a)(2)(A) of this title](/usc/42/13251.md?p=a-2-A).
- (c) **Credit not a section 13258 credit—** A credit under this section shall not be considered a credit under [section 13258 of this title](/usc/42/13258.md).
- (d) **Issuance of rule—** The [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) shall, before January 1, 1999, issue a rule establishing procedures for the implementation of this section.
- (e) **Collection of data—** The [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) shall collect such data as are required to make a determination described in [subsection (f)(2)(B)](#f-2-B).
- (f) **Definitions—** For purposes of this section—
  - (1) the term “biodiesel”—
    - (A) means a diesel fuel substitute produced from nonpetroleum renewable resources that meets the registration requirements for fuels and fuel additives established by the Environmental Protection [Agency](/usc/42/8262.md?p=1) under [section 7545 of this title](/usc/42/7545.md);
    - (B) includes biodiesel derived from—
      - (i) animal wastes, including poultry fats and poultry wastes, and other waste materials; or
      - (ii) municipal solid waste and sludges and oils derived from wastewater and the [treatment](/usc/42/11851.md?p=11) of wastewater; and
  - (2) the term “qualifying volume” means—
    - (A) 450 gallons; or
    - (B) if the [Secretary](/usc/42/242q–4.md?p=2) determines by rule that the average annual [alternative fuel](/usc/42/13211.md?p=2) use in light duty vehicles by [fleets](/usc/42/13211.md?p=9) and [covered persons](/usc/42/13211.md?p=5) exceeds 450 gallons or gallon equivalents, the amount of such average annual [alternative fuel](/usc/42/13211.md?p=2) use.

## Source credit

(Pub. L. 102–486, title III, § 312, as added Pub. L. 105–277, div. A, § 101(a) [title XII, § 1201(a)], Oct. 21, 1998, 112 Stat. 2681, 2681–48; Pub. L. 105–388, § 7(a), Nov. 13, 1998, 112 Stat. 3480; Pub. L. 109–58, title XV, § 1515, Aug. 8, 2005, 119 Stat. 1091.)

### References in Text

The date of the enactment of this section, referred to in subsec. (a)(1), probably means October 21, 1998, the date of the enactment of this section by Pub. L. 105–277, rather than Nov. 13, 1998, the date of the enactment of this section by Pub. L. 105–388.

### Codification

Pub. L. 105–277 and Pub. L. 105–388 enacted identical sections.

### Amendments

2005—Subsec. (f)(1). Pub. L. 109–58 inserted dash after “ ‘biodiesel’ ”, designated remainder of existing provisions as subpar. (A), and added subpar. (B).
